1

Kommentare und Zeilenumbrüche in Ninox Scripten erlauben und beibehalten

1. Kommentare in Scripten

Es wäre super, wenn zum einen Kommentare möglich wären in der Form /* Kommentar */ oder ähnlich. Idealerweise auch über mehrere Zeilen hinweg. 

2. Zeilenumbrüche in Scripten beibehalten.

Längerer Script-Code wird durch Zeilenumbrüche deutlich lesbarer und besser wartbar.

19 Antworten

null
    • Ninox-Professional
    • planoxpro
    • vor 7 JahrenThu, March 29, 2018 at 12:01 PM UTC
    • Gemeldet - anzeigen

    Ja, dem schließe ich mich an. Eine Möglichkeit zur Kommentierung in Skripten wäre wirklich hilfreich. Vielleicht habe ich ein besonders schlechtes Gedächtnis, aber ich weiß oft schon nach einigen Tagen nicht mehr, warum ich den Code so und nicht anders erstellt habe. Ideal für das "Debugging" wäre zudem, wenn man Teile des Codes komplett auskommentieren könnte. Man braucht für Ninox zwar keine umfangreichen Skripte, aber da sie ja möglich sind, "passiert" es halt doch immer wieder mal ... ;)

    • Ninox Premiumpartner
    • Bastian_Vorholt
    • vor 7 JahrenThu, March 29, 2018 at 12:09 PM UTC
    • Gemeldet - anzeigen

    Ja Kommentare find ich echt ein sehr wichtiges feature. Genauso fehlt mir die Möglichkeit aus Ninox auch direkt anhänge per Mail zu versenden. Auskommentieren find ich auch sehr Hilfreich, gerade wenn man ein Script geschrieben hat und es nach einem Update plötzlich einfacherere Möglichkeiten gibt, es mit weniger Code Zeilen umzusetzen, daran sieht man dann hinterher auch ein wenig die Entwicklung.

    • simon
    • vor 7 JahrenSat, June 2, 2018 at 12:11 PM UTC
    • Gemeldet - anzeigen

    👍

    v.a. zum Auskommentieren ist es notwendig.

    • Dirk_Pulver_2020
    • vor 7 JahrenMon, June 4, 2018 at 6:24 AM UTC
    • Gemeldet - anzeigen

    Jep - Kommentare wären sehr hilfreich

    • Claus
    • vor 7 JahrenThu, June 7, 2018 at 2:56 PM UTC
    • Gemeldet - anzeigen

    diesem Wunsch schließe ich mich ausdrücklich an ;-)

    • jmbrenn_webde
    • vor 7 JahrenSun, June 10, 2018 at 5:03 AM UTC
    • Gemeldet - anzeigen

    ...absolut wünschenswerte features, gerade bei der (dankenswerterweise) stark wachsenden Funktionsvielfalt von NINOX und den daraus resultierenden Möglichkeiten in Scripten

    • info.17
    • vor 6 JahrenTue, November 6, 2018 at 9:18 PM UTC
    • Gemeldet - anzeigen

    Vote!

    • tschijoh
    • vor 6 JahrenThu, November 8, 2018 at 7:52 AM UTC
    • Gemeldet - anzeigen

    Das würde ich auch für wünschenswert halten. So wie bei Numbers, wo man sich Notizen an der Zelle machen kann.

    • info.17
    • vor 6 JahrenThu, November 8, 2018 at 8:35 AM UTC
    • Gemeldet - anzeigen

    /* Der richtige Syntax wird ja von Ninox bereits erkannt */

    Leider nur automatisch gelöscht.

    • Support
    • vor 6 JahrenThu, November 8, 2018 at 9:36 AM UTC
    • Gemeldet - anzeigen

    Hallo, 

    diese Änderung steht schon auf unserer Liste der Verbesserungen und soll auch bald realisiert werden.

    Momentan kann man sich mit der Belegung einer Variablen helfen, um einen Kommentar zu hinterlegen: 

    let meinKommentar := "Das ist mein Kommentar zum folgenden Abschnitt...."

    Danke für Eure Geduld bis zur Umsetzung der echten Kommentarfunktion.

    Gruß, Jörg

    • Leonid_Semik
    • vor 6 JahrenThu, November 8, 2018 at 9:53 AM UTC
    • Gemeldet - anzeigen

    ----

    "

    / Der richtige Syntax wird ja von Ninox bereits erkannt und sogar grün eingefärbt

    "

    ---

    "----------------------------------------
    /Oder so/
    -----------------------------------------"

     

    https://ninoxdb.de/de/forum/technische-hilfe-5ab8fe445fe2b42b7dd39ee8/kommentare-workaround-v2-5ba3d8e1aa94e557220109d6

     

    Leo

    • tschijoh
    • vor 6 JahrenThu, November 8, 2018 at 9:59 AM UTC
    • Gemeldet - anzeigen

    Hallo Jörg,

    gibt da ein Beispiel mit der Belegung einer Variablen. Bin doch Laie. Gruß Jens

    • Support
    • vor 6 JahrenThu, November 8, 2018 at 10:03 AM UTC
    • Gemeldet - anzeigen

    Hallo Jens, 

    das Beispiel stand schon im Text, der war nur schlecht formatiert von mir, sorry. Hier noch einmal die Zeile, die du so in ein Formelfeld einfügen kannst (du solltest halt nur den Text in den Anführungszeichen deinem Kommentar anpassen ;))

     

    let meinKommentar := "Das ist mein Kommentar zum folgenden Abschnitt....";

     

    Gruß, Jörg

    • Leonid_Semik
    • vor 6 JahrenThu, November 8, 2018 at 10:18 AM UTC
    • Gemeldet - anzeigen

    Ich schreibe es ohne Variablen, einfach mit Anführungszeichen:

    ---

    let my:=this;

    "

    /Hier fähngt eine Schleife an"

    for i in Untertabelle do

    i.Datum:=today()

    end;

    "

    /Hier endet die Schleife"

    ---

    Leo

    • Martin_K
    • vor 6 JahrenFri, November 9, 2018 at 9:25 AM UTC
    • Gemeldet - anzeigen

    Ich habe mir angewöhnt bei Projekten den Code auszudokumentieren wie auch unter Xcode, dort geht es gar nicht anders. Zum Coden verwende ich parallel den TextWrangler light um den Code ausdokumentieren zu können. Es kann ja in Ninox Scripten manchmal vorkommen das kein Fehler angezeigt wird und trotzdem der Code nicht interpretiert werden kann und plötzlich der Code verschwunden ist.. Durch das externe Speichern und Ausdokumentieren hab ich zugleich die Möglichkeit privat eine Bibliothek zu besitzen um darauf zurück greifen zu können ohne mich durch Projekte hanteln zu müssen. Trotz alledem währe eine Überarbeitung  des Editors eine willkommene Erweiterung. 

    • Paul_Krummling
    • vor 4 JahrenThu, January 21, 2021 at 11:09 AM UTC
    • Gemeldet - anzeigen

    Gibt es hierzu bereits Neuigkeiten? (über 2 Jahre her

    • Leonid_Semik
    • vor 4 JahrenThu, January 21, 2021 at 11:39 AM UTC
    • Gemeldet - anzeigen

    Hallo Paul,

    nein, es bleibt bei Anführungszeichen. Ich mache es mittlererweile so:

    ---
    "
    //Kommentar
    ";

    ---
    Dann ist die Zeile orange-eingefärbt.

    Leo

    • marcg2
    • vor 3 JahrenFri, December 17, 2021 at 5:50 AM UTC
    • Gemeldet - anzeigen

    gibt es hier Neuigkeiten? das Thema ist ja fast 3 Jahre alt!

    • Michael_Fessl
    • vor 2 JahrenTue, June 6, 2023 at 2:04 PM UTC
    • Gemeldet - anzeigen

    Immer noch nichts Neues ??

Content aside

  • 1 „Gefällt mir“ Klicks
  • vor 2 JahrenTue, June 6, 2023 at 2:04 PM UTCZuletzt aktiv
  • 19Antworten
  • 7009Ansichten
  • 1 Folge bereits